Coincidentally I was shooting down in the Toronto subway on the weekend too and I was curious about how Frank took that. So I downloaded the pic and peeked at the EXIF: 21mm, f/4, 1/40 sec, ISO 1600. The TTC subway is indeed very bright. I was shooting with an 50mm f/1.4 lens wide open and had accidentally left the Auto-ISO mode on, so the K100D selected 200 ISO and cranked the shutter down to 1/20 on me. (I got some acceptable shots anyway.
